Amet Wrote:sure, this is what I added in joystickappleremote.xml under <FullscreenVideo> since I am on ATV. it activates script by holding menu on a remote.



if you are using a keyboard, find "keyboard.xml" under keymaps folder and copy it to /user/{your_name}/.xbmc/userdata/keymaps/ (you might need to create keymaps folder). rename it to keyboard_own.xml and add following under <FullscreenVideo>
<keyboard>:



restart XBMC and "s" should start script while in fullscreen only.

- amet - 2009-11-06

wild_oscar Wrote:Now more on a "review" comment/question, I am comparing this script with Boxee's one and have two remarks:

1) Do you know why the search seems slower than in boxee? You seem to be filtering the search to the languages in the settings. Could this cause a slower query than if all results are shown? Have you tried benchmarking the script's query against boxee's query?

I have used Boxee for about 15 minutes and i gave up on it. this script has some roots in he Boxee Subtitle script but the search function for OpenSubtitles has been rewritten according to Brano's(OpenSubtitle.org Administrator) instructions. Language preferences are sent with the search query so there is no filtering results. we only get the wanted languages.

wild_oscar Wrote:2) On a personal taste, I prefer boxee's search box size and location (seems less obtrusive). Is this a simple thing to change in the script (position, size and perhaps font size)? I haven't fiddled around with the source yet, what file(s) is that information located in?

It depends on which skin are you, you can look under OpenSubtitles_OSD/media/skins/Default/720p/, different xml files for different skins.

Zeljko
